Save the date! Join us November 14, 2009 at the Texas Motorplex in Ennis, Texas for the Latemodel Restoration Supply 10th Anniversary Celebration! Don't miss this one day event filled with lots of test and tune or grudge match racing down one of the fastest 1/4 miles in the nation! This event will be open to all of our customers that have a Mustang, Challenger, Chevy truck, Ford Truck, Dodge Truck and more. Pre-registration info and more details COMING SOON!

 It's been ten great years but the best is yet to come!
